Question

a football team won 3 matches for every \\(\frac{1}{2}\\) match they lost. what is the ratio of matches won to matches lost?

Explanation:

Step1: Identify the given ratio components

The team won 3 matches for every $\frac{1}{2}$ match lost. So the number of won matches ($W$) is 3, and the number of lost matches ($L$) is $\frac{1}{2}$.

Step2: Calculate the ratio of won to lost

The ratio of matches won to lost is $W:L = 3:\frac{1}{2}$. To simplify this ratio, we multiply both parts by 2 to eliminate the fraction. So, $3\times2:\frac{1}{2}\times2 = 6:1$.

Answer:

The ratio of matches won to matches lost is $6:1$.
